Think about it! Improving defeasible reasoning by first modeling the question scenario

Defeasible reasoning is the mode of reasoning where conclusions can be\noverturned by taking into account new evidence. Existing cognitive science\nliterature on defeasible reasoning suggests that a person forms a mental model\nof the problem scenario before answering questions. Our research goal asks\nwhether neural models can similarly benefit from envisioning the question\nscenario before answering a defeasible query. Our approach is, given a\nquestion, to have a model first create a graph of relevant influences, and then\nleverage that graph as an additional input when answering the question. Our\nsystem, CURIOUS, achieves a new state-of-the-art on three different defeasible\nreasoning datasets. This result is significant as it illustrates that\nperformance can be improved by guiding a system to "think about" a question and\nexplicitly model the scenario, rather than answering reflexively.
